  3. Jun 30, 2023 · J.H.S. 157 - Stephen A. Halsey is a highly rated, public school located in REGO PARK, NY. It has 1,542 students in grades 6-9 with a student-teacher ratio of 15 to 1. According to state test scores, 67% of students are at least proficient in math and 70% in reading.
